Guy Martin breaks world's fastest tractor record after hitting speed of 153mph

Guy Martin has smashed the world record…. for the fastest tractor after reaching a top speed of 153mph in a five-tonne JCB.

The lorry mechanic turned motorbike racer adapted a Fastrac 4000 to beat the existing world record set by Top Gear’s The Stig of 87.2mph last year.

JCB partnered with Channel 4 to follow his journey on Guy Martin:The world’s Fastest Tractor on Channel 4.

The 38-year-old, is used to racing motorbikes around the TT track in the Isle of Man.

Guy visits Ricardo Engineering to help convert a basic 220bhp JCB Fastrac engine into a 1000bhp monster, as well as using cutting-edge VR technology to improve the machine’s aerodynamic profile.

The JCB Fastrac 4000 was specially modified with help from Formula 1 designers Williams Engineering.

Usually it has a top speed of 44mph from its 350bhp engine.

On the show, he takes it to one of the longest runways in Britain, Elvington Airfield near York, and attempts to enter the record books as the first person to ever drive a tractor at over 100mph.

Driving the Fastrac Two, Guy hit an astonishing peak speed of 153.771mph, recording an average of 135.191mph.

He said: “This has been a massive undertaking, and I was a very small cog in the machine.

"It was a proper privilege to be involved, so thank you very much to JCB and its engineering team, who got this tractor absolutely spot-on.

"Just look at it, they get stuff done, it’s brilliant, and it is still a working tractor, so could have gone straight into the nearest field to put in a shift."

This isn’t the first of Guy’s challenges - in November 2018, Channel 4 screened Guy Martin: The World’s Fastest Van? where he rebuilt his beloved transit van and tried to break the van lap record at Nürburgring in Germany.
